Few things beat a decent plate of nachoā€™s!!
Was a place in East Lansing on M.A.C avenue at MSU called 'ā€˜The Underrgoundā€™ that had several restaurants and a pinball arcadeā€¦the Mexican cafe there was known for their ā€˜Botanasā€™ā€¦ a huge platter of both flour and corn tortillas fried into chips-- topped with beans, shredded pork, beef or chicken, lots of cheese, shredded lettuce, picco de Gallo, guacamole and Queso blanco ā€¦sour cream or spicy ranch on the sideā€¦ for like $4 you could feed 3-4 peopleā€¦and still have $$ left for the arcade!
